Revision: 39890
          
http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=39890
Author:   campbellbarton
Date:     2011-09-03 12:39:17 +0000 (Sat, 03 Sep 2011)
Log Message:
-----------
svn merge -r39877:39878 
https://svn.blender.org/svnroot/bf-blender/trunk/blender, merged manually

Revision Links:
--------------
    
http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=39877

Modified Paths:
--------------
    branches/bmesh/blender/release/scripts/modules/bpy_types.py
    branches/bmesh/blender/source/blender/bmesh/operators/mesh_conv.c
    branches/bmesh/blender/source/blender/editors/object/object_hook.c
    branches/bmesh/blender/source/blender/editors/object/object_relations.c

Property Changed:
----------------
    branches/bmesh/blender/
    
branches/bmesh/blender/release/scripts/startup/bl_operators/add_mesh_torus.py
    
branches/bmesh/blender/release/scripts/startup/bl_operators/uvcalc_smart_project.py
    
branches/bmesh/blender/release/scripts/startup/bl_operators/vertexpaint_dirt.py
    
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_armature.py
    bran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_bone.py
    
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_camera.py
    
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_empty.py
    bran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_lamp.py
    
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_lattice.py
    bran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_mesh.py
    
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_metaball.py
    
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_modifier.py
    branches/bmesh/blender/release/scripts/startup/bl_ui/properties_game.py
    branches/bmesh/blender/release/scripts/startup/bl_ui/properties_material.py
    branches/bmesh/blender/release/scripts/startup/bl_ui/properties_particle.py
    
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_physics_field.py
    
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_physics_fluid.py
    
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_physics_smoke.py
    branches/bmesh/blender/release/scripts/startup/bl_ui/properties_texture.py
    branches/bmesh/blender/release/scripts/startup/bl_ui/properties_world.py
    branches/bmesh/blender/release/scripts/startup/bl_ui/space_node.py
    branches/bmesh/blender/source/blender/editors/render/render_update.c
    branches/bmesh/blender/source/blender/editors/space_outliner/
    branches/bmesh/blender/source/blender/editors/uvedit/uvedit_buttons.c


Property changes on: branches/bmesh/blender
___________________________________________________________________
Modified: svn:mergeinfo
   - /trunk/blender:31524-39877
   + /trunk/blender:31524-39878

Modified: branches/bmesh/blender/release/scripts/modules/bpy_types.py
===================================================================
--- branches/bmesh/blender/release/scripts/modules/bpy_types.py 2011-09-03 
10:49:54 UTC (rev 39889)
+++ branches/bmesh/blender/release/scripts/modules/bpy_types.py 2011-09-03 
12:39:17 UTC (rev 39890)
@@ -183,7 +183,7 @@
     @property
     def center(self):
         """The midpoint between the head and the tail."""
-        return (self.head + self.tail) * 0.5
+        return self.head.lerp(self.tail, 0.5)
 
     @property
     def length(self):
@@ -568,7 +568,7 @@
         draw_funcs = cls._dyn_ui_initialize()
         try:
             draw_funcs.remove(draw_func)
-        except:
+        except ValueError:
             pass
 
 


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_operators/add_mesh_torus.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_operators/add_mesh_torus.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_operators/add_mesh_torus.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_operators/uvcalc_smart_project.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_operators/uvcalc_smart_project.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_operators/uvcalc_smart_project.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_operators/vertexpaint_dirt.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_operators/vertexpaint_dirt.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_operators/vertexpaint_dirt.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_armature.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_armature.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_armature.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_bone.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_bone.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_bone.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_camera.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_camera.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_camera.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_empty.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_empty.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_empty.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_lamp.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_lamp.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_lamp.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_lattice.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_lattice.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_lattice.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_mesh.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_mesh.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_mesh.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_metaball.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_metaball.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_metaball.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_data_modifier.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_modifier.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_data_modifier.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_game.py
___________________________________________________________________
Modified: svn:mergeinfo
   - /trunk/blender/release/scripts/startup/bl_ui/properties_game.py:36154-39877
   + /trunk/blender/release/scripts/startup/bl_ui/properties_game.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_material.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_material.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_material.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_particle.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_particle.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_particle.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_physics_field.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_physics_field.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_physics_field.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_physics_fluid.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_physics_fluid.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_physics_fluid.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_physics_smoke.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_physics_smoke.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_physics_smoke.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_texture.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_texture.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_texture.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/properties_world.py
___________________________________________________________________
Modified: svn:mergeinfo
   - 
/trunk/blender/release/scripts/startup/bl_ui/properties_world.py:36154-39877
   + 
/trunk/blender/release/scripts/startup/bl_ui/properties_world.py:36154-39878


Property changes on: 
branches/bmesh/blender/release/scripts/startup/bl_ui/space_node.py
___________________________________________________________________
Modified: svn:mergeinfo
   - /trunk/blender/release/scripts/startup/bl_ui/space_node.py:36154-39877
   + /trunk/blender/release/scripts/startup/bl_ui/space_node.py:36154-39878

Modified: branches/bmesh/blender/source/blender/bmesh/operators/mesh_conv.c
===================================================================
--- branches/bmesh/blender/source/blender/bmesh/operators/mesh_conv.c   
2011-09-03 10:49:54 UTC (rev 39889)
+++ branches/bmesh/blender/source/blender/bmesh/operators/mesh_conv.c   
2011-09-03 12:39:17 UTC (rev 39890)
@@ -620,7 +620,7 @@
                int i,j;
 
                for (ob=G.main->object.first; ob; ob=ob->id.next) {
-                       if (ob->parent==ob && ELEM(ob->partype, 
PARVERT1,PARVERT3)) {
+                       if (ob->parent==bm->ob && ELEM(ob->partype, 
PARVERT1,PARVERT3)) {
                                
                                /* duplicate code from below, make it function 
later...? */
                                if (!vertMap) {

Modified: branches/bmesh/blender/source/blender/editors/object/object_hook.c
===================================================================
--- branches/bmesh/blender/source/blender/editors/object/object_hook.c  
2011-09-03 10:49:54 UTC (rev 39889)
+++ branches/bmesh/blender/source/blender/editors/object/object_hook.c  
2011-09-03 12:39:17 UTC (rev 39890)
@@ -65,6 +65,7 @@
 
 #include "ED_curve.h"
 #include "ED_mesh.h"
+#include "ED_lattice.h"
 #include "ED_screen.h"
 
 #include "WM_types.h"
@@ -297,7 +298,7 @@
        return totvert;
 }
 
-static int object_hook_index_array(Object *obedit, int *tot, int **indexar, 
char *name, float *cent_r)
+static int object_hook_index_array(Scene *scene, Object *obedit, int *tot, int 
**indexar, char *name, float *cent_r)
 {
        *indexar= NULL;
        *tot= 0;
@@ -307,7 +308,10 @@
                case OB_MESH:
                {
                        Mesh *me= obedit->data;
-                       BMEditMesh *em = me->edit_btmesh;
+                       BMEditMesh *em;
+                       EDBM_LoadEditBMesh(scene, obedit);
+                       EDBM_MakeEditBMesh(scene->toolsettings, scene, obedit);
+                       em = me->edit_btmesh;
 
                        /* check selected vertices first */

@@ Diff output truncated at 10240 characters. @@
_______________________________________________
Bf-blender-cvs mailing list
[email protected]
http://lists.blender.org/mailman/listinfo/bf-blender-cvs

Reply via email to